Understanding Routing Number 086500634

Routing number 086500634 is a 9-digit code used to identify financial institutions in transactions. Known as an RTN or transit number, it ensures accurate direction of your funds.

When Do You Need a Routing Number

The routing number 086500634 is essential for funds transfers to or from your account. Note that it's not used for debit or credit card transactions.

Locating the Routing Number on a Paper Check

Find the 086500634 routing number at the bottom left corner of your check or on your Central Bank statement.
